Enrollment process for Partner Universities

Enrolment process for Partner Universities

  1. Before the closing deadline 15 March 2012 Partner Universities must send per email to dfs@adm.au.dk a list of students who will be on tuition waiver basis and those who will be freemovers.
     
  2. All students must apply online no matter weather they apply as freemovers or tuition waived basis.
     
  3. Some students might apply on AU online page and forget to submit their application to your University. However once we have received a student list from you, we will compare the list against the online applicants from your University and tell us if there’s any students whose name appears on your system but not our nomination list.
     
  4. All tuition waived students from Partner Universities must hand in the following documentation:
    - a front-page with your stated name, address, and date of birth clearly stated
    - a copy of your passport
    - a transcript showing the courses of your current studies and your Bachelor's degree diploma (If you are a Master student)
  5. Freemovers from Partner Universities must hand in documentation as follows:
    - a front-page with your name, address, and date of birth clearly stated
    - a transcript showing the courses of your current or previous studies and your Bachelor degree diploma (If you apply for a course at Master level)
    -
    a copy of your secondary education/high school diploma
    - an English test as you are expected to have a high level of English proficiency
    - a copy of your passport
  6. AU accepts the qualified the tuition waived students and freemovers nominated by your          University based on their qualifications. Once AU has made its selection on exchange students and freemovers we will issue offer letters to the students and send them directly to the students copied you in the email.
  7. AU will bill freemovers directly
    for the program fee and all students for housing payment (as stated on program website).

In spring 2011, Aarhus University’s nine main academic areas were reduced to four, and the fifty-five departments became twenty-six. This was to unify the organisation and to strengthen the university’s interdisciplinary approach.
